Under Florida Law ยง 95.11( 5 )(a), you usually have two years from the day of injury to submit a personal injury claim. The accident law of restrictions was 4 years up until 2023. This filing due date puts on the majority of injury situations, consisting of cars and truck mishaps, slip and falls, and dog bites. Failing to file your automobile accident case within the defined law of restrictions can have significant repercussions. If you miss the two-year deadline, the court will likely reject your case, and you will certainly shed the chance to seek settlement via the lawful system.
